How they compare

Maldives currently reports 0.0028 kt against 0 kt in Montserrat, a difference of 0.0028 kt.

The two have swapped places 3 times across 34 shared years of data; in 1990 it was Montserrat ahead.

Maldives ranks 193rd and Montserrat ranks 194th of 221 countries.

Across the 4 decades both report, Maldives averaged higher in 2 and Montserrat in 2.

The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
